Hi, I've purchased a CloudMail license. I'm going to use it in an environment with 1 FileMaker Server v14 and 12 FileMaker Pro v14 clients.

The database is already on the server, and the plugin is activated, but I'm not able to use CloudMail functions with a client that doesn't have the plugin installed.

How can I register the license and use the database from a client?

Thanks

Hi T_C,

If you are using the CloudMail.fmp12 file to use CloudMail then the scripts are currently set up to run locally. Hosting the file will not make the scripts use the plugin that you have installed on the Server.  You can only use the plugin on the server via the PSOS script step or scheduled script. You can modify the scripts to run on Server if you like otherwise you will need to install the plugin on your client machines.

Of note, if you decide to run the scripts via PSOS or scheduled script, you will need to modify them to have the registration function at the beginning of every script that is going to run on FMS.

Thanks Ryan,

can I register my license on all the fileMaker Pro clients? Or I need extra licenses?

 

An Enterprise level license can be used for an unlimited amount of users within the same organization so you should be able to use the same license for all your FileMaker Pro clients.
